Dr. Martens Teams up With The Met for a Creative Collaboration

Two icons are coming together as Dr. Martens and The Met have partnered together for a collaborative collection truly out of this world. Celebrating renowned Japanese artist Katsushika Hokusai's 36 Views of Mount Fuji series, the launch consists of three pieces, The Met 1460 boot,  1461 shoe and The Met backpack. Nike Dresses the Air Max 97 in a Women's Exclusive "Pink"

Nike is updating its Air Max 97 lineup with a *groundbreaking* women's exclusive colorway -- "Pink."The classic silhouette arrives in a pastel pink makeup, maintaining a tonal look with the mini Swooshes and the rest of the upper in the same hue. The kicks are accompanied by 3M reflective overlays throughout, while the kicks sit atop a "Sail" midsole. UGG and Designer Shayne Oliver Join Forces for FW22 Campaign

Winter is coming and UGG is partnering with New York-based designer Shayne Oliver to create a Fall/Winter 2022 collection that effortlessly merges both brands' distinctive aesthetics.
